**Test Plan Note — Firmware Channel Validation.** Plugin authors targeting the Ironquill device fleet must verify that update manifests published to the beta channel are signed and versioned monotonically. Test cases should cover rollback refusal, partial-download resume, and checksum mismatch handling. Use the staging channel at Oakmere, never production, for destructive tests. All manifest publish and fetch calls against the staging channel must be authenticated with the bearer token below.

session JWT of yawep-yawep = eyJhbGciOiJIUzI1NiIsInR5cCI6IkpXVCJ9.eyJzdWIiOiI3pWF3_In0.aXYsHiog

## Deployment

The Quillstone markdown rendering pipeline ships as a single container. Release managers should promote the staging image after the render-diff job passes; no manual asset rebuild is needed. Rollbacks are safe because rendered output is cached by content hash, not version. Sanitizer rules load at boot, so a restart is required after any rule change. The service reads the following configuration values at startup.

deployment values, yadug-bawif:
[framir]
team = pelox
access_code = ac_a38ab2
owner = tamion.julael
host = framir.tolvaqlabs.test
port = 11211
peer = tammir.zemvargrid.local
salt = 2215ef03
pin = 1541

Q: The Beepline barcode scanner integration stops syncing after a vault reset — what now?

A: A vault reset wipes the scanner's paired credentials. Re-run the pairing wizard, then unseal the integration keystore manually; scans queue locally until it's unsealed. The keystore accepts only the recovery passphrase set at initial provisioning, which is the following.

vault phrase of taweg-kafof = oliax-zorael

Welcome to the Fanlark notification platform. When downstream channels slow, the fan-out workers apply backpressure by shrinking batch sizes rather than dropping events; watch the lag gauge in Pulseboard before tuning anything. To query the backpressure metrics endpoint from your sandbox, authenticate using the key provided below.

API key for kafop-fafof: qvz3-4pw